The Georgia power bank market is witnessing significant growth propelled by the increasing adoption of mobile devices and the need for portable charging solutions. Power banks are portable battery packs used to recharge smartphones, tablets, and other electronic devices on the go. With a growing reliance on mobile technology and the need for uninterrupted connectivity, consumers in Georgia are investing in power banks for added convenience and peace of mind. Manufacturers in Georgia are producing a wide range of power banks with different capacities, designs, and features to meet market demand, driving market expansion and diversification in the region.
The power bank market in Georgia is experiencing robust growth driven by several factors. One of the primary drivers is the increasing penetration of smartphones and other portable electronic devices, which has created a strong demand for portable power sources to keep these devices charged on the go. Additionally, the growing trend of remote working and outdoor activities has led to a higher reliance on mobile devices, further boosting the need for power banks. Moreover, advancements in battery technology, such as the development of lithium-ion batteries with higher energy densities and faster charging capabilities, are driving market growth by enhancing the performance and convenience of power banks. Furthermore, the rising awareness of energy conservation and the need for backup power solutions during emergencies are also contributing to the expansion of the power bank market in Georgia.
In the Georgia power bank market, challenges stem from technological innovation, battery safety, and market saturation. Power banks, used for portable device charging, face challenges such as battery capacity, charging speed, and compatibility with different devices. Ensuring power bank reliability, safety, and compliance with regulatory standards requires rigorous testing, certification, and quality control measures. Moreover, addressing concerns about battery degradation, overheating, and explosion risk necessitates investment in battery technology advancements and safety features. Additionally, meeting diverse customer needs and market demands for compactness, lightweight, and fast-charging solutions requires continuous innovation in power bank design, materials, and electronics. Furthermore, adapting to changing consumer preferences, device compatibility, and competitive landscape requires agility and responsiveness from power bank manufacturers. Overcoming these challenges requires collaboration between industry stakeholders, battery manufacturers, and regulatory authorities to develop and promote safe, efficient, and user-friendly power bank solutions that meet consumer expectations and market demands.
